Food ingredients
fennel ( 100g ) | Eggs ( 2 ) |
All-purpose flour ( 200g ) | Water ( 100g ) |
Yeast ( 2g ) | Edible oil ( appropriate amount ) |
Sesame oil ( 1/2 tsp ) | Fresh soy sauce ( 1/2 tsp ) |
Salt ( 4g ) | Chicken Powder ( appropriate amount ) |
Sesame seeds ( appropriate amount ) | Onions ( appropriate amount ) |
How to make fennel pancakes

1.Add yeast to flour and stir evenly.

2. Slowly pour in warm water, stir the flour into floc, and knead it into a smooth dough.Cover with plastic wrap and ferment at room temperature.

3. Beat the eggs.

4. Heat the pan with cold oil.When the oil temperature rises, add the egg liquid and stir-fry until the eggs solidify.Then turn off the heat.

5. Chop the green onions.

6. Wash and chop fennel.

7. Add the chopped green onion and chopped fennel into the scrambled eggs.

8. Add all seasonings and mix well.

9. Dust the chopping board with light flour, take out the dough and deflate it.

10. Roll the dough into a long strip and divide it into 6 equal portions.

11.Press flat and roll out into a thick middle and thin edge.Me

12.Take a pot and add appropriate amount of fennel filling.

13.Pinch and tighten.

14.Close the mouth downward and press it flat.

15. Make all the sesame cake bases in turn and brush the surface with water.

16. Brush the water with sesame seeds.

17. Stick sesame seeds on all the biscuits and put them on the baking sheet.Place in the middle rack of the preheated oven at 200 degrees Celsius and bake for 15 minutes.

18.When the time is up, take out the baking pan.Fennel pancakes are ready!

Tips
If you don’t have an oven, you can use an electric baking pan.
